Output 06526cc307eccdcc0c301a6d2c417762ccc63a46fb939d66268ae40e73da4f35:17

value
2191677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b0fb040f9cf3516246083280358785e2587d9f2 OP_EQUAL
address
3ENJeGFGSQJ9bAYLHejirKvWmCBpH2ic9d
transaction
06526cc307eccdcc0c301a6d2c417762ccc63a46fb939d66268ae40e73da4f35
spent
true